KEY CHANGES TO TOYOTA AFL DREAM TEAM FOR 2011
- Squad sizes increased from 30 players to 33. This allows for an extra defender, midfielder and forward on the bench. The larger squad is designed to help cover for when players are unavailable due to their club having the bye.

- Given the salary cap will rise only in accordance with the real one under which the AFL clubs operate, player prices will be lowered overall to reflect the need to fit 33 players under the cap rather than 30.
- An additional four trades made available for the season (taking total trades to 24), with the limit of two per round to remain.
- Head-to-head matches start in round one and are suspended during the five rounds when three AFL clubs have a bye.
